FetchContent is cleaner than ExternalProject_Add() and works without this PR. Closing this as unnecessary.

It might still be a good idea to have an install step, but there's probably more considerations than just putting a lib & header in system dirs. For example, the Nix flake doesn't seem to install either! No need to force the issue.
